Aman-Tehreek (Pakistanis for Peace) helps CSI

CSI greatly appreciates Aman Tehreek's support. Aman-Tehreek (Pakistanis for Peace) is a group of students (from Stanford, Harvard, Cornell), academics, professionals, and concerned individuals in the U.S. working to mobilize funds for the IDPs in Pakistan. This group is working with the Civil Society Group in Islamabad as well as the Global Peace Council in NWFP. The group personally keeps account of all funds, and sends donors regular feedback, pictures, and updates on where the money is spent; this personal-to-person accountability is how Aman Tehreek hopes to engage individuals who are far away from the crisis in Pakistan, and keep them involved.
